A Moment Captured: Elena in a Yellow Tunic by Joaquín Sorolla
Joaquín Sorolla y Bastida’s “Elena in a Yellow Tunic,” painted in 1909, is more than just a portrait; it's an exquisite distillation of light and emotion, a quintessential example of the Spanish master’s unparalleled ability to capture the ephemeral beauty of everyday life. Measuring 112 x 92 cm, this oil on canvas work immediately draws the viewer into a scene of quiet contemplation, dominated by the vibrant hue of the subject's tunic – a color that seems to pulse with warmth and vitality.
- The Subject: Elena, seated with an air of dignified seriousness, embodies the spirit of the Spanish bourgeoisie at the turn of the century. Her posture, her gaze directed towards the viewer, invites intimacy and a sense of shared understanding.
- Sorolla’s Technique: The artist's masterful brushwork is immediately apparent. Loose, confident strokes build up layers of color, creating a shimmering effect that mimics the play of sunlight on skin and fabric. This technique, honed through years of observation and experimentation, is central to Sorolla’s signature style – one characterized by its luminous quality.
- Color as Emotion: The deliberate use of yellow isn't merely decorative; it carries significant symbolic weight. Yellow represents joy, optimism, and enlightenment, aligning perfectly with Sorolla’s fascination with capturing moments of happiness and serenity. The contrast between the bright tunic and the darker shawl creates a dynamic visual tension, further enhancing the painting’s impact.
A Window into the World of 1909 Spain
"Elena in a Yellow Tunic" offers a fascinating glimpse into Spanish society during the early 20th century. Sorolla was deeply embedded within Valencia's vibrant artistic and social circles, capturing the essence of life along the Mediterranean coast. The painting reflects the growing influence of Impressionism and plein air painting – movements that encouraged artists to work outdoors, directly observing and translating natural light onto canvas. This commitment to realism, combined with a heightened sense of color and emotion, firmly established Sorolla as one of Spain’s leading artists.
- Historical Context: Painted during a period of relative prosperity in Spain, the work reflects the optimism and confidence of the era.
- Sorolla's Influences: While deeply rooted in Spanish tradition, Sorolla was also influenced by the works of artists such as Claude Monet and Pierre-Auguste Renoir, demonstrating his openness to new ideas and techniques.
Light, Shadow, and the Soul
Sorolla’s genius lies not just in his technical skill but in his profound understanding of light – a central element of his artistic philosophy. He meticulously studied how sunlight interacts with surfaces, creating dramatic contrasts between light and shadow that give his paintings their characteristic luminosity. The *chiaroscuro* employed here is particularly effective in sculpting Elena’s form, emphasizing her features and adding depth to the composition. This careful manipulation of light isn't merely a stylistic choice; it serves to evoke an emotional response in the viewer, inviting us to contemplate the beauty and fragility of human existence.
